Talbot Row is a residential street with 10 addresses.
It ranks as the 190th largest and 431st most expensive of the 1,032 streets in the NE5 area. The dominant property type is a modern house built after 1980.
The street contains a total of 10 properties: 10 houses.
Sale prices range from £128,550 for 3 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(703 ft2) to £146,011 for 3 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(957 ft2) .
Monthly rental prices range from £986 pcm for 3 bed houses to £1,049 pcm for 3 bed houses.
The gross rental yield is between 8.6% and 9.2%.
The average value per square foot is £169.
The current average value in the street is £134,758.
The Talbot Row Sales Market has increased by 34.1% over the last 10 years.
